WebBackground. Dash DataTable is an interactive table component designed for viewing, editing, and exploring large datasets. DataTable is rendered with standard, semantic HTML markup, which makes it accessible, responsive, and easy to style.. This component was written from scratch in React.js and Typescript specifically for the Dash community. WebWe are currently working on the initial open-source release of Dash AG Grid, which will be v2.0.0. If you’d like to try out the alpha version today, install it with: pip install dash-ag-grid== 2.0.0 a1. If you pip install dash-ag-grid (without specifying the alpha version number), you will get a non-functional stub package.

Most examples illustrate how to manually pick certain columns/rows taken … the people of nigeriaWebDec 11, 2024 · The Dash Datatable has a property “Data” that is a list of Dictionary of the current values of the table. It also has the property “data_previous” with the information that had before.
